Masaccio pioneered what style of realistic art?
zloy xaker [14]

Answer:

Among these creative pioneers was the artist known as Masaccio (1401-1428) who, along with his contemporaries, paved the way for later Renaissance art. His use of linear perspective and the vanishing point, as well as his acute attention to realism, made him the first great painter of the Italian Renaissance.

Distinguish between a draped garment, a tailored garment, and a composite garment. Include examples of each
Harman [31]

A draped garment is garment that is made out an entire piece of cloth. It is not cut or fitted in any shape or form like fitted garments are. Many use clips, clasps, belts, sashes or fibulae to tie this together and give shape to the garment, however some rely on friction and gravity alone. Examples of draped garments could be one of the following but are not limited to:

-Cloaks

-Shawls

-Togas

-Stolas

-Chitons

-saris

Or ponchos.

A composite garment are garments that are hung or wrapped around/on the body or object that have folds of characteristics like soft fabric do, they can be tailored and sewn also. They are a combination of drape and tailor methods An example of Composite garments are :

-Capes

-robes (such as bathrobes)

- kimonos

And tunics.

Tailored garments are of course garments that are created through the cutting of the garment/fabric pieces and sewing or fitting them together to be able to fit the body or object. This may be used to fit dresses and suits. Examples of tailor garments include

-anything made to particular specifications or conditions such as

-Shorter arms on a blazer

-bust or other area measurements such as hips

-dresses for special occasions such as wedding dresses (likewise for suits)
